copyright Currency: Understanding the Legal Ramifications & Available Options
Dealing with spurious currency presents serious legal problems click here and few options for those who handle it inadvertently . Possessing, circulating imitation bills is a national crime, potentially causing hefty fines and likely imprisonment. While unsuspecting individuals may accidentally accept forged money, the law generally considers them responsible. Your recommended course of action includes immediately informing the matter to local law enforcement authorities and the Secret Service, and refusing to take any further questionable bills. There are few avenues for getting back the lost value, but cooperation with investigators might help in identifying the source of the illegal currency.
